Selecting good therapies under integrative medicine: Acupuncture

This done by the insertion of hair thin, stainless steel needles into the skin at the strategic locations. Its role is to manipulate the energy flows into the body and it has been proven to be effective in the treatment of nausea, pains and vomiting. It is also being considered for treatment of asthma, menstrual cramps, and osteoarthritis.

Selecting good therapies under integrative medicine: Yoga

Yoga, which means “to yoke” or “to unite,” is an ancient practice intended to unify the body and mind, the individual and the universal. While Westerners typically think of hatha yoga, which stresses physical postures, breathing exercises, and meditation, there are actually many types of yoga, most of which can be practiced by people of all levels of health and fitness. Overall, the practice seeks to balance and integrate mind, body, and spirit; to enhance energy flow; and to stimulate the body’s natural healing processes by teaching people how to release tension, relax, strengthen weak muscles, and stretch tight ones.

beginning of sexualityThere had been times when sex and sexuality were one of the least discussed topics, they were more like taboos. But nowadays it’s perfectly normal to discuss them; these are still fairly personal but no more considered as forbidden knowledge. The terms Sexuality and sexual orientation are sometimes alternatively used for each other and to a great extant its well justified. Sexuality is about understanding your personal sexual feelings and attractions towards others while sexual orientation is exploring your sexuality and placing yourself in pre-defined categories such as heterosexuality, homosexuality, bisexuality and asexuality. There is no definite age at which sexuality begins as there are multiple environmental and social factors that are responsible for it. Biological and socially the age of beginning depends upon Gender, hormonal balance, ethnicity, family values, substance and drug use, socioeconomic makeup, religious beliefs, cultural views about sex, women liberation etc.

It’s not justified to say that sexuality only begins when a child starts understanding its environment because we all are sexual beings, even  an infant have a different overall body structure and organs distinctly a male or a female or sometimes both, these factors through some extant can predict a child’s sexual orientation. On the other hand young children are usually curious about their bodies, between ages zero to five, it is considered normal for them to touch their own body parts and also ask questions about related topics.

Gender plays a very important role in the onset of sexuality. It refers to the socially constructed roles, behaviors, activities, and attributes that are assigned to men and women in any given society There are defined gender roles and expectation in every society that how men and women should behave. There are cultures where it is alright for men to talk about sex whether women are expected to stay silent on these matters. They cannot be assertive about their sexual preference and orientation; simply they are not given enough liberation to express their sexual desires.

The hormonal theory of sexuality and gender identity explains in detail that, exposure to certain hormones  at early stages of development plays a very important role in fetal sex differentiation, such exposure also has a strong influence on the sexual orientation and or gender identity that emerges later in the adult. Differences in brain structure that come about from chemical messengers and genes interacting on developing brain cells are believed to be the basis of sex differences in countless behaviors, including sexual orientation. Prenatal factors that affect or interfere with the interaction of these hormones on the developing brain can influence later sex-typed behavior in children. On the other hand hormonal production and balance biologically determines the increased awareness of sexual behaviors in children. Usually children start facing hormonal changes after the age of ten that greatly impacts their attitude towards sex and sexuality.

Socioeconomic and environmental issues have long been discussed as key role players in the onset of sexuality in children. Within sound socio economic settings, children are more exposed to facilities such as internet, magazines, sex educations guides and most importantly social media at an early age. Also in cultural settings where public show of affection is culturally accepted, children possess early beginning of sexuality. They have more references to real life so they could understand their own desires in a much better way as compared to those children who do not have access to our basic information systems and facilities. The trends of proper sex education in a culture can enhance the rates of children getting involved in sexual habits at an early age. On the other hand educated families tend to be more open about sex and sex education with their children. The question “what is the appropriate age?” for discussing such personal and sensitive topics with children has haunted parents and psychologists for a long time, but now it’s an established fact that healthy sex education can greatly reduce the risk of children developing aberrant sexual habits due to wrong information from wrong sources.

In societies where children can have easy access to drugs and other similar substances, it has been seen that sexual behavioral abnormalities and early understanding of sexual practices occur as one of the many side effects of these drugs. The concept of normal and abnormal habits is totally relevant to the age of a child. There are practices that are considered for a child five years of age but the same practices are normal for a child around ten years of age.

One more important parameter in determining the commencement of sexuality is religious practices. Religious practices often forbid extra marital sex, and private habits like masturbation. From a psychological perspective it is perfectly normal a child to have inappropriate thoughts and touching their own body parts but these same practices are at time forbidden, when these practices are strictly followed, children are kept socially isolated from being getting indulged in such activities that can delay social inception of sexuality.

In conclusion, the commencement of sexuality can not only be based one or few factors, it’s a complex process which has equal involvement of biological processes and social and environmental practices around the individuals. Sexuality cannot be generalized, every individual is unique and so are their experiences towards life, there are multiple encounters that shape the sexual orientation of a child. Even once decided and sorted out, there are significant chances that a person’s sexuality can change over the period of time. Low carbohydrate diets effectiveness and health benefits: How safe are low carbohydrate diets?

The question of safety is very vital and scientific evidence has confirmed that low carbohydrates are indeed safe. This has been further affirmed by the fact that over the years the indigenous Eskimos who were gatherers lived and thrived for centuries feeding essentially on almost carbohydrate free diet and no trace of complications were registered in them. It therefore means that the body can actually survive on a zero grams of carbohydrate and so eliminating carbohydrate from your diet will certainly not cause any harm to your health.

Besides the factors of safety highlighted above, it is important to note that, this is only applicable where one is in perfect health. That is to say if an individual is under certain medication like for instance that of any chronic health conditions like diabetes, heart disease or high blood pressure, such individuals needs to be under close supervision by their physician from the initial stages of this diet. This is very necessary for the medication dosage to be proper. The reason why this is necessary is because this diet can have a powerful effect on your body chemistry quite very fast. With that the blood pressure and blood sugar can naturally fall towards more normal values even in just a few days, thereby necessitating the need for medication dosages to be reduced progressively to avoid any possible serious medication side effects.

Low carbohydrate induction phase

Like with all new things sometime of adaptation will be necessary. If you are going to begin using low carb diet for the first time, things may not be as normal in the early stages of usage. Like for instance in most cases the first few hours (24-72 hours) of being introduced on a very low-carbohydrate diet, you will be faced with some tough situations as your body makes adjust to living without dietary sugars and starches. During this period of adaptation you are likely to feel some changes in your system including being irritable, hungry, moody and tired most of the time. You could also have trouble with sleeping and just feeling restless and unease. It is however important to note that these are very normal experiences and once you get through that preliminary withdrawal period, your body shall have become adaptable to the new environment and you will be able to feel much better.
